How they compare

Republic of Korea currently reports 1.66 million m3 against 1.32 million m3 in Yugoslav SFR, a difference of 336,000 m3.

That makes Republic of Korea's figure about 1.3 times Yugoslav SFR's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Yugoslav SFR ahead.

Republic of Korea ranks 30th and Yugoslav SFR ranks 32nd of 215 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Republic of Korea averaged higher in 1 and Yugoslav SFR in 3.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
